I got it to work with compton compositing manager. thank you Antonio and Germán.

this command worked for me:
compton --detect-client-opacity

> This is from the GTK documentation (used in IUP for the opacity attribute):
> 
> "gtk_widget_set_opacity ()
> 
> void gtk_widget_set_opacity (GtkWidget *widget, double opacity);
> 
> Request the widget to be rendered partially transparent, with opacity 0 being 
> fully transparent and 1 fully opaque. (Opacity values are clamped to the 
> [0,1] range.). This works on both toplevel widget, and child widgets, 
> although there are some limitations:
> 
> For toplevel widgets this depends on the capabilities of the windowing 
> system. On X11 this has any effect only on X screens with a compositing 
> manager running. See gtk_widget_is_composited(). On Windows it should work 
> always, although setting a window’s opacity after the window has been shown 
> causes it to flicker once on Windows.
> 
> For child widgets it doesn’t work if any affected widget has a native window, 
> or disables double buffering."

>>>>>>> I just tested in GTK 2.20 and it worked ok with
>>
>>>>>>>
>>
>>>>>>> IupSetAttribute(dialog,"OPACITY","128");
>>
>>>>>>>
>>
>>>>>>> Notice that a value of "1" is almost fully transparent.
